How to Optimize Lead Scoring in Formaloo for Better Sales Results
Lead scoring determines how quickly your sales team acts on a lead, and how accurately you identify high-intent buyers. With Formaloo, you can build a complete scoring engine using variables, conditional logic, On Submit automations, and real-time dashboards. This turns your lead capture form into a full qualification workflow that routes the right leads to the right people immediately.

Step 1 – Create Your Lead Capture Form
You can start from scratch or use Lead generation form and custom CRM template from the Template Gallery.
To accelerate creation, you can also use Magic Create. Try:
Prompt:
“Lead scoring form with qualification fields, intent questions, budget ranges, and automated scoring variables.”
Your form should include fields such as:
- Full name, email, company name
- Company size, industry
- Buying timeline
- Budget
- Use case or pain point
- Lead source
- Engagement indicators (e.g., product interest, feature selection)
💡 Tip: Use multi-step pages to separate Profile → Intent → Needs.

Step 2 – Add Variable Fields to Calculate Scores
Formaloo’s variable fields allow you to assign or deduct points automatically.
Common variable categories:
score_intentscore_profilescore_engagementscore_total
Example rules:
- If “Buying timeline = This month” → Add 20 to
score_intent - If “Company size > 200 employees” → Add 15 to
score_profile - If “Budget = $10k+” → Add 10 to
score_profile
You can then sum them into score_total.

Step 3 – Categorize Leads Automatically Using On Submit Logic
Once the score is calculated, use On Submit logic to classify leads:
- Hot Lead: score_total ≥ 60
- Warm Lead: 35–59
- Cold Lead: < 35
On Submit automations let you:
- Update the “lead status” field
- Send internal notifications
- Redirect to a meeting scheduler (e.g., Calendly)
- Fire a webhook to your CRM
- Assign leads to the right sales rep

Step 4 – Trigger Smart Follow-Ups and Notifications
Set up email or Slack notifications when conditions are met.
Examples:
- Hot leads: Instant email + Slack to sales
- Warm leads: Personalized nurture email
- Cold leads: Add to long-term drip campaigns
- Enterprise-fit leads: Redirect to a booking page
- Non-qualified leads: Light-touch thank-you email

Step 5 – Enrich Leads Automatically
To increase scoring accuracy, enrich leads using:
- UTM hidden fields
- IP-based region detection
- Webhooks to tools like Clearbit, Apollo, or internal systems
- Custom CRM integrations
- Formaloo lead enrichment
This ensures your scoring logic receives the cleanest, richest data possible.

Step 6 – Build a Real-Time Lead Scoring Dashboard
Turn your form into a CRM-style app using:
- Tables showing all captured leads
- Kanban boards grouped by lead status
- Charts visualizing score distribution
- Filters for reps to see only their assigned leads
Visual insights help your team understand:
- Which sources generate high-intent leads
- How many leads fall into each scoring band
- Profile factors influencing score

Pro Tips for Higher Sales Impact
- Build multiple score layers (fit + intent + engagement) for accuracy
- Add hidden tracking fields to catch lead source and UTM data
- Use answer piping to personalize the form experience
- Assign leads to the right sales rep based on geography, size, or product need
